117.info
人生若只如初见

如何在Linux中为Compton配置GPU加速

Compton 是一个开源的、轻量级的 compositor,通常用于 X11 或 Wayland 显示服务器。它支持各种特效,如阴影、模糊、渐变等。然而,Compton 本身并不直接支持 GPU 加速。要实现 GPU 加速,通常需要依赖于特定的库或框架,比如使用 CUDA 或 OpenCL。

如果你想要在 Linux 上为 Compton 配置 GPU 加速,你可能需要考虑使用支持 GPU 加速的 compositor,如 Radeon RX Vega 64Radeon GPU Profiler 或者 NVIDIAOptiX。这些工具可以提供 GPU 加速的渲染和计算能力。

如果你仍然想要尝试为 Compton 配置 GPU 加速,你可以考虑以下步骤:

  1. 安装 NVIDIA 驱动程序和 CUDA Toolkit
  • 安装 NVIDIA 驱动程序:根据你的显卡型号,从 NVIDIA 官方网站下载并安装相应的驱动程序。
  • 安装 CUDA Toolkit:从 NVIDIA 官方网站下载并安装适合你系统的 CUDA Toolkit。
  1. 配置环境变量
  • 编辑 ~/.bashrc~/.zshrc 文件,添加以下内容:
export PATH=/usr/local/cuda/bin:$PATH
export LD_LIBRARY_PATH=/usr/local/cuda/lib64:$LD_LIBRARY_PATH
  • 使环境变量生效:
source ~/.bashrc
  1. 安装 Compton
  • 从 Compton 的 GitHub 仓库克隆并安装 Compton:
git clone https://github.com/Compton-Epilogue/Compton.git
cd Compton
sudo make install

请注意,Compton 并不是一个高性能的 compositor,它的主要目的是提供简单的特效。如果你需要更高级的 GPU 加速功能,你可能需要考虑使用其他更适合的 compositor 或工具。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fec9fAzsNAwRfDVw.html

推荐文章

  • 如何优化SecureCRT在Linux上的性能

    要优化SecureCRT在Linux上的性能,可以参考以下建议: 选择合适的协议: 确保使用SSH协议,因为它提供了加密的远程登录方式,确保传输数据的安全性。 配置会话属...

  • Linux Aliases在系统管理中的作用

    Linux Aliases在系统管理中扮演着重要的角色,它们可以极大地提高命令行操作的效率和便捷性。以下是Linux Aliases在系统管理中的主要作用:
    提高效率 简化复...

  • LNMP如何进行资源调度

    LNMP是指Linux、Nginx、MySQL和PHP的组合,这是一个非常流行的用于部署Web应用的架构。在LNMP架构中,资源调度主要涉及Linux操作系统的资源管理、Nginx的负载均衡...

  • 如何简化Linux Informix日常维护工作

    简化Linux Informix的日常维护工作可以通过以下几个步骤来实现: 自动化脚本: 编写脚本来自动化常规任务,如备份、日志清理、性能监控等。
    使用cron作业定...

  • 在Linux中Compton是否必要

    在Linux中,Compton并不是系统运行的必需服务。Compton是一个轻量级的窗口合成器,通常用于提供更好的视觉效果和性能,特别是与窗口管理器(如Openbox、i3等)配...

  • Debian下PHP安全设置怎么做

    在Debian系统下进行PHP安全设置,可以参考以下步骤和建议:
    1. 更新系统和软件包 保持系统和所有软件包都是最新的,以修补已知的安全漏洞。sudo apt update...

  • 如何用SecureCRT进行远程监控

    使用SecureCRT进行远程监控主要涉及安装、配置SecureCRT以及通过它连接到远程服务器进行监控。以下是详细步骤:
    安装SecureCRT 访问VanDyke Software官网下...

  • Debian系统exploit修复方法是什么

    Debian系统被利用漏洞攻击后,需要采取一系列措施进行修复。以下是修复的步骤:
    启动修复模式 如果系统无法正常启动,可以在启动时按下Ctrl+Alt+F1(或F2、...